#Five-axis linkage machine tools are widely used in high-end manufacturing industries

Machine tools are mainly composed of basic components, spindle components, feed mechanisms, CNC systems, auxiliary devices, etc. A machining center refers to a CNC machine tool with a tool magazine and an automatic tool changer, which allows the workpiece to automatically and continuously complete multiple processes such as milling, drilling, boring, reaming, tapping, and grooving after one clamping. If the machining center is equipped with an automatic indexing rotary table or the spindle box can automatically change the angle, the workpiece can also be automatically processed on multiple surfaces and in multiple processes after one clamping. Therefore, in addition to processing various complex curved surfaces, the machining center is very suitable for processing complex parts such as various boxes and plates.

Machining centers are classified according to their layout, mainly including vertical machining centers, horizontal machining centers, gantry machining centers, composite machining centers, etc.

According to the classification of CNC systems, CNC systems control several coordinates to coordinate motion at the same time according to the required functional relationship, which is called coordinate linkage. According to the number of linkage axes, it is divided into two-axis linkage, two-axis and semi-linkage, three-axis linkage, four-axis linkage, and five-axis linkage. Linkage etc. Five-axis linkage CNC machining mainly means that there are at least 5 coordinate axes (three linear coordinates and two rotational coordinates) on a machine tool, and the 5 axes can be interpolated at the same time to process parts.

Five-axis machine tool structures include table tilt type, spindle tilt type and table/spindle tilt type five-axis processing machine tools. 5 Axis CNC Machining Service and linkage CNC technology is one of the important standards for measuring the technical level of a country’s complex precision parts manufacturing capabilities. #The global market size will exceed US$7 billion in 21, and the domestic market space will be approximately RMB 10 billion

According to statistics from QY Research, the global five-axis CNC machine tool market size reached US$7.48 billion in 2021, and the industry size is expected to reach US$13.8 billion in 2027, with a compound annual growth rate of 10.05% during the period.

According to QY Research data, the majority of global five-axis CNC machine tools are monopolized by leading overseas companies such as DMG Mori Machinery, Yamazaki Mazak, Hammer, GROB and Doosan. In 2020, the market share of the top five manufacturers reached 62%, and the top ten manufacturers accounted for more than 80% of the industry’s market share; Code CNC is the leading domestic five-axis machine tool company. In 2020, the revenue of five-axis CNC machine tools was only 172 million yuan, and the market share 0.39%.

The domestic five-axis market space in 2021 will be approximately 10 billion yuan, and is expected to reach 18.683 billion yuan in 25 years. According to data from the Machine Tool Industry Association, China’s metal processing machine tool imports in 2021 will be US$7.46 billion, of which machining center imports will be US$2.636 billion, accounting for 35.7%. It is assumed that 60% of the machining center imports are five-axis machine tools (considering the high unit price of five-axis in ordinary machining centers), corresponding to a market space of US$1.595 billion, equivalent to RMB 10.309 billion, accounting for 21.38% of the global market. Based on global market data predicted by QY Research, considering that the demand for five-axis machine tools in the domestic market will continue to increase driven by the increase in the proportion of high-end manufacturing on the one hand, and on the other hand the entry of domestic enterprises into the market will accelerate cost reduction and promote the replacement of three-axis machine tools by five-axis machine tools to increase penetration, assuming In 2025, China’s market share in the global market will reach 25.38%, and the domestic market space will reach 18.683 billion yuan in 2025.

The localization rate of China’s five-axis machine tools is less than 10%, and there is huge room for domestic substitution. The high-end domestic machine tool market is mainly monopolized by overseas companies. As of 2018, the localization rate of China’s high-end machine tools was only 6%. We estimate that the current localization rate of five-axis machine tools is still less than 10%.

At present, the revenue volume, production and sales volume of domestic five-axis machine tool companies are far behind those of overseas leaders, and domestic companies have huge room for growth. Taking DMG Mori Machinery and Code CNC as examples, DMG Mori Machinery achieved revenue of RMB 21.945 billion in 2021, a year-on-year increase of 20.63%, and Code CNC’s revenue in 2021 was RMB 254 million. DMG Mori Machinery’s global sales volume is 11,574 units in 2021, and Code CNC’s sales volume is 126 units in 2021. There is huge room for growth.

#There is strong demand in new energy vehicles, aerospace and other fields, which is expected to bring growth opportunities to domestic companies

The downstream applications of five-axis CNC machine tools are mainly in aerospace, automotive, military and other fields. According to QY Research data, the sales of five-axis machine tools in the aerospace, automotive, and military industries accounted for 39.9%/24.3%/13.3% respectively. Among them, the automotive field is mainly used to produce cylinder blocks and automotive parts; the aerospace field is mainly used to produce aircraft blisks, engines and other precision parts.

Judging from the order data of Japanese machine tools exported to China, high-end machine tools have maintained strong demand resilience in the down cycle of general machinery this year. From January to August 2022, new orders signed by key enterprises contacted by the China Machine Tool Industry Association fell by 6.2% year-on-year. However, Japanese machine tool orders exported to China were basically the same year-on-year under the high base last year. In 2021, Japan’s exports of machine tool orders to China increased significantly by 77% to 358.04 billion yen (21.03 billion yuan based on the average exchange rate in 2021). From January to August 2022, Japan’s exports of machine tool orders to China increased by 0.72% year-on-year, returning to positive growth under the high base last year. According to monthly data, orders began to weaken in January this year and began to rebound in a trend in June.

The fields of new energy vehicles and aerospace are expected to drive continued growth in demand for five-axis machine tools and bring growth opportunities to domestic enterprises:

  • 1) Aerospace field: There is strong demand for domestic substitution of five-axis machine tools, and the domestic large aircraft industry chain continues to release incremental market demand. Five-axis machine tools have many application scenarios in the aerospace field, covering the processing of aircraft structural parts, landing gear, blades, casings, compressor impellers and other components. As domestically produced large aircraft gradually enter mass production, the demand for five-axis machine tools is expected to continue to increase. At the same time, under the influence of trade friction, the aerospace field is in urgent need of high-end machine tools that can realize import substitution, and the incremental market space is expected to be tilted towards domestic enterprises.
  • 2) New energy vehicles: The advancement of new processes such as integrated die-casting is expected to continue to increase the demand for five-axis machine tools. New energy vehicle manufacturing is transforming towards lightweight and integrated manufacturing, and integrated special-shaped structural parts are expected to provide opportunities for the application of five-axis machine tools.

#Domestic companies have entered the market to accelerate cost reduction and are expected to increase the penetration rate of five-axis machine tools to replace three-axis machines

Five-axis machine tools bring economy through higher processing efficiency, smaller footprint and energy consumption, and have certain substitution for three-axis machine tools. According to data disclosed by DMG Mori Seiki, the world’s leader in five-axis machine tools, it used 10 five-axis machine tools to replace 50 vertical five-side processing machine tools, resulting in higher processing volume, smaller footprint, and energy savings42 %.

We believe that the penetration rate of five-axis machine tools is expected to continue to increase:

  • 1) Supply side: Domestic companies have entered the market to accelerate cost reduction, which will drive the economic efficiency of five-axis machine tools to continue to improve. The high price and high cost of five-axis machine tools are due to the high cost of core components such as CNC systems and swing heads. Currently, we see that the technological maturity of domestic CNC systems and functional components continues to improve, which is expected to drive the cost of domestic five-axis machine tools to continue to decrease. Taking Code CNC as an example, the external selling price of its self-developed CNC system is 50% lower than the average price of Siemens 840D, while the gross profit margin of standard products is more than 50%.
  • 2) Demand side: Five-axis machine tools will become the core for private enterprises to enhance product competitiveness. In order to improve processing efficiency, save space and labor costs, meet the diversification of product processing, and comply with marketization trends, more and more companies will choose five-axis machine tools to enhance product competitiveness.

#Technology: From functional components to host manufacturing, domestic five-axis machine tool technology has gradually matured and has the basis for domestic substitution.

From the perspective of the composition of five-axis machine tools, compared with three-axis machine tools, five-axis machine tools mainly add/upgrade components such as five-axis CNC systems, swing heads, and turntables.

The difficulty in manufacturing five-axis machine tools is mainly reflected in the high requirements for high-end CNC systems and functional components, while the domestic industry chain is less mature and relies on imports of core components. On the one hand, the price of domestic five-axis machine tools remains high, and subsequent maintenance costs are high. , the speed of popularization is limited; on the one hand, it suppresses the profits of domestic enterprises:

  • 1) CNC systems are currently mainly imported from manufacturers such as Siemens, HEIDENHAIN, FANUC, Mitsubishi, etc. The import costs are high and they are also subject to blockade restrictions. Some high-end modules are not correct. China opens up to imports.
  • 2) Functional components are dependent on imports. At present, the degree of specialization of the domestic industrial chain such as swing heads, turntables, measurement feedback components, etc. is far behind that of the West. There are few varieties and unstable quality. High-end functional components are dependent on imports, which affects the profits of machine tool factories.

#CNC system: Kede CNC and Huazhong CNC have achieved a breakthrough in the five-axis CNC system from 0 to 1

Code CNC and Huazhong CNC are among the first companies in China to develop CNC systems. Currently, their high-end CNC systems have achieved benchmarking with leading international products such as Fanuc and Siemens. Code CNC equipped with self-developed CNC system five-axis linkage machine tools has entered the market. In high-end manufacturing fields such as aerospace, Huazhong CNC cooperates with machine tool companies such as Halma CNC, Neway CNC, Ningbo Haitian, Changzhou Ruiqisheng, and Dongguan Evermi, and its penetration rate in the field of high-end CNC systems continues to increase.

Kede CNC and Huazhong CNC have basically realized the servo drive and motor matching of high-end CNC systems.

Taking the Huazhong CNC system as an example, it currently covers RTCP functions, right-angle head bidirectional tool length compensation, swing head indexing, dynamic accuracy measurement, digital display hand crank, inclined tool facing, zero position protection function in fully closed-loop mode, tool axis direction Typical five-axis functions such as length compensation, five-axis inclined plane processing, normal advance and retreat, linear interpolation, and great circle interpolation can meet the needs of five-axis machining.

#Functional components: The supply chain is mature and the self-made capabilities of enterprises are improved, from relying on imports to letting a hundred flowers bloom.

From the perspective of the supply chain, some leading manufacturing companies are currently extending into the machine tool industry chain to accelerate the maturity of the supply chain of functional components:

  • 1) Hengli hydraulic cutting screw manufacturing is expected to support the machine tool industry chain. In September 2021, Hengli Hydraulics released a non-public issuance plan, planning to invest 1.527 billion yuan to build a linear drive project, which includes an annual production capacity of 100,000 meters of standard ball screws and 100,000 meters of heavy-duty ball screws. Hengli Hydraulics, leveraging its world-leading precision processing and manufacturing capabilities, is expected to replace domestically produced brands such as Japan’s NSK and Germany’s Schaeffler, and provide supporting equipment in the machine tool industry.
  • 2) Green Harmonic and Haozhi Electromechanical have launched harmonic CNC turntables. Based on high-precision harmonic reducers, the turntable has excellent performance in terms of transmission accuracy, transmission torque, accuracy retention, and lifespan.

From the perspective of machine tool factories, currently Code CNC, Evermi (subsidiary of Topstar), etc. have realized the core self-developed functional components of five-axis machine tools, and the self-made rate of subsequent machine tool factories is expected to continue to increase:

  • 1) Code CNC in addition to CNC In addition to the self-developed and self-made supporting components of the system, functional components such as the swing head and turntable are also self-made. With the support of direct drive/double direct drive technology, the functions, control accuracy and processing efficiency have reached the international advanced level.
  • 2) Evermi realizes self-made spindles, swing heads, and cradle turntables, based on core technologies such as European GTRT high-end mechanical transmission technology and self-developed patented gear backlash elimination technology, with excellent rigidity, stability, and precision.
  • 3) The Jinan No. 2 machine tool double-swing angle milling head project passed national acceptance. In 2021, the major national special project “Research and Application Demonstration of Key Technologies for Double Swing Angle Milling Heads of CNC Machine Tools” led by Jinan No. 2 Machine Tool Group Co., Ltd. successfully passed the comprehensive performance evaluation and final file acceptance in Hanzhong, Shaanxi. We have conquered a series of key technologies such as serialization of double swing angle milling heads, manufacturing of key parts, static/dynamic accuracy adjustment, compensation and performance optimization, matching with domestic CNC systems, and reliability verification, and completed the development of 40 sets of products for users in key fields. #”Independent and controllable” related policies and financial support, domestic substitution of five-axis machine tools is expected to accelerate

Policy assistance: Policies for the development of China’s high-end machine tool industry have been frequently issued. In recent years, the Ministry of Industry and Information Technology, the National Development and Reform Commission, the State-owned Assets Supervision and Administration Commission and other departments have issued relevant policies to support the development of China’s high-end CNC machine tools; in addition, the Ministry of Finance and the State Administration of Taxation in September 2022 Issue policies to reduce or reduce taxes and fees incurred by high-tech enterprises when purchasing new equipment.

Investment assistance: General Technology Group and the National Manufacturing Transformation and Upgrading Fund have increased investment in the machine tool sector.

  • 1) China General Technology Group originally owned Machine Tool Research Institute, Qi’er Machine Tool, Harbin and other companies. It reorganized Dalian Machine Tool Group and Shenyang Machine Tool Group in April and December 2019 respectively. In May 2021, it also cooperated with Tianjin Municipal Government The State-owned Assets Supervision and Administration Commission signed a memorandum of understanding to deepen strategic cooperation. The two parties jointly invested 10 billion yuan to deepen the development of high-end precision CNC machine tools, key functional components and industrial Internet services. Machine tools have become one of the core businesses of General Technology Group.
  • 2) The Transformation Fund was established in 2019 and has invested in many machine tool companies. In November 2019, CRRC announced the establishment of the National Manufacturing Transformation and Upgrading Fund Co., Ltd. (Transformation Fund) with 19 shareholders, with a registered capital of 147.2 billion yuan, mainly focusing on new materials, new generation information technology, power equipment and other fields.Companies in the growth and maturity stages invest. In June 2022, the Transformation Fund participated in the private placement of Code CNC and planned to subscribe for 150 million yuan. In November 2021, it invested 300 million yuan in Rifa Precision Machinery. In October 2021, 594 million yuan was invested in Genesis. At the same time, the transformation fund began to involve upstream enterprises in the machine tool industry chain, and strategically invested in Su Great Wall Precision Technology Co., Ltd. (formerly Changshu Great Wall Bearing Co., Ltd.), which is expected to accelerate the maturity of the machine tool industry chain.
  • 3) Two CSI Machine Tool ETFs were listed to strengthen investment in the machine tool industry chain. Two CSI Machine Tool ETFs from China Asset Management and Cathay Fund have been listed, which are the first fund products in the machine tool field approved for listing. Both ETFs track the CSI Machine Tool Index and involve listed companies in the fields of design, manufacturing and services of complete machine tools and key components such as CNC systems, spindles and cutting tools.
